Ready to wear
(114)
- Ready to wear (114)
BLAZERS
EARRINGS
BOOTS
BODYSUITS
TRENCH COATS
MINI DRESSES
NECKLACES
MIDI SKIRTS
SANDALS
BLAZERS
EARRINGS
BOOTS
BODYSUITS
TRENCH COATS
MINI DRESSES
NECKLACES
MIDI SKIRTS
SANDALS
eola SKIRT
£195
assia skirt
£440
camine DRESS
£525
basile T-shirt
£120
jilla dress
£260
pops jacket
£335
boop jacket
£345
kierel jacket
£385
dola dress
£280
malicia skirt
£205
apoldie dress
£240
molly dress
£260
meona skirt
£195
fastway dress
£270
pippa skirt
£450
pona skirt
£400
aisha dress
£240
shawn jacket
£385
ainara coat
£400
ceven dress
£280
cayrel skirt
£205
coleene jacket
£315
payton skirt
£260
pavel dress
£345
slopa skirt
£185
peace jacket
£345
crispy dress
£230
volentia skirt
£205
dahlia dress
£260
petronia dress
£345
ceecee jacket
£345
valentia skirt
£205
friea skirt
£205
ulae dress
£230
haris dress
£260
linona DRESS
£240
claurys BOOTS
£410
polar coat
£345
simos skirt
£185
astoria dress
£175
cyrilia dress
£240
math skirt
£185
faye skirt
£400
epona jacket
£345
bowo dress
£280
suez skirt
£240